Risk-Based Monitoring in Clinical Trials: A Preparation Guide for Research Sites

The landscape of clinical trials is undergoing rapid change. As studies become more complex and global, sponsors and regulators are turning to innovative monitoring methods to ensure data quality and patient safety. One of the most impactful of these is Risk-Based Monitoring (RBM), a strategy that utilizes data analytics and technology to identify, assess, and proactively address potential risks. For research sites, understanding and preparing for RBM is essential. Whether you’re managing your first trial or have years of experience, this approach requires new skills, systems, and mindsets. CRA vs CRC: Understanding the Key Roles in Clinical Research

Are you considering a career in clinical research? You may have come across the CRA vs CRC debate. While both positions are essential to the success of clinical trials, their responsibilities, work settings, and career trajectories differ in important ways.  Understanding these distinctions can help aspiring professionals choose the right path and clarify how each role contributes to advancing safe and effective medical treatments.
